Output fba8d2ff39da9060d7cfafdb232c95c6c583581a34a34b6291f763f01fe5228d:1

value
995605
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 740af0f29876a03b7b38ef9cb4aeb895fbfc5879 OP_EQUALVERIFY OP_CHECKSIG
address
1BaaVThd2rTZEE4V3rbQ4ZArkkTG677FbM
transaction
fba8d2ff39da9060d7cfafdb232c95c6c583581a34a34b6291f763f01fe5228d
spent
true